Minecraft boasts 20 million players


If there comes a month which is devoid of Minecraft statistics I think it’d be safe to say the apocalypse must have comee and gone. The latest figures, as announced by Minecraft creator Markus ‘Notch’ Persson, show that the ‘game’ has 20 million registered users.
For some reason unbeknownst by myself (and everyone else of Earth), Notch goes on to add that if the average weight of a Minecraft player is 70kg then the total weight of all players combined is equal to 1/4 of the weight of the Great Pyramid of Giza.
